Essential Steps for Filing a Comprehensive Car Accident Claim
When pursuing a car accident claim maximum payout, the initial documentation process becomes critically important. Immediately after an accident, gather as much evidence as possible including photos of vehicle damage, skid marks, traffic signals, and any visible injuries. In 2025, many drivers utilize dashcams and smartphone apps specifically designed for accident documentation, which can significantly strengthen your case. Remember to obtain contact information from all witnesses, as their statements may prove invaluable during the claims process.
The best way to file insurance claim after accident involves promptly notifying your insurance provider while being careful with your initial statements. Many companies now offer mobile claim filing options with AI-assisted damage assessment, but it’s still advisable to get an independent professional evaluation. When describing the incident, stick to verifiable facts rather than speculation about fault. This measured approach prevents insurers from using early statements against you during settlement negotiations.
Maximizing Your Compensation Through Strategic Documentation
To achieve a car accident claim maximum payout, thorough medical documentation is essential. Even if injuries seem minor initially, seek professional medical evaluation as some symptoms appear hours or days after the trauma. In 2025, many healthcare providers offer specialized post-accident assessments that document potential long-term impacts insurers might otherwise overlook. Keep detailed records of all treatments, medications, and therapy sessions, as these form the foundation for calculating pain and suffering damages.
The best way to file insurance claim after accident includes creating a comprehensive impact statement detailing how the accident has affected your daily life. Document lost wages, missed opportunities, and any lifestyle adjustments required due to injuries. Contemporary claims often include quality-of-life metrics and expert testimony about long-term consequences that weren’t traditionally considered in settlement calculations. This holistic approach to documenting non-economic damages can significantly increase your potential compensation.
Effective Negotiation Strategies with Insurance Companies
Understanding how to negotiate car accident settlement requires recognizing insurer tactics. Claims adjusters in 2025 use sophisticated algorithms to evaluate cases, often making low initial offers. Prepare counterarguments backed by comparable settlement data from similar cases, which is now more accessible through various legal databases. Highlight aspects of your claim that might trigger higher valuation parameters in their systems, such as documented permanent injuries or substantial vehicle depreciation.
When learning how to negotiate car accident settlement, timing becomes a strategic factor. Many insurers have quarterly or annual claim resolution targets that can work in your favor. Present your complete demand package when they’re most motivated to settle cases, typically near these deadlines. Contemporary negotiation often involves hybrid processes combining digital communication for documentation with in-person or video conferences for more nuanced discussions about pain and suffering valuations.
Leveraging Technology in Modern Accident Claims
The pursuit of a car accident claim maximum payout now benefits from advanced accident reconstruction technologies. Many legal teams use 3D modeling software and telematics data from vehicles to create compelling visual representations of collisions. These tools help overcome the “he said, she said” scenarios that often reduce settlement amounts. If your vehicle has event data recording capabilities, preserve this information as it can provide crucial details about speed, braking, and impact forces at the moment of collision.
The best way to file insurance claim after accident in 2025 involves utilizing digital tools while maintaining human oversight. Automated claim systems can process straightforward property damage quickly, but complex injury claims still require professional evaluation. Consider using claim management apps that track medical expenses, document symptom progression, and even remind you of important deadlines, but always have an experienced attorney review the final submission before filing.
Special Considerations for High-Value Claims
For those seeking a car accident claim maximum payout, certain case aspects warrant particular attention. Claims involving commercial vehicles, rideshare incidents, or accidents with uninsured motorists often involve different valuation parameters. Many policies now include specific provisions for emerging accident scenarios like autonomous vehicle malfunctions or electric vehicle battery fires. Understanding these nuances can mean the difference between an average settlement and exceptional compensation.
The how to negotiate car accident settlement process changes when dealing with severe injuries or permanent disabilities. In these cases, structured settlements with long-term payout options may provide better financial security than lump-sum payments. Contemporary negotiations often involve life care planners who project future medical needs and calculate present values for ongoing treatments. These specialized approaches require experienced legal representation but can yield substantially higher total compensation packages.
Finalizing Your Claim for Optimal Results
When implementing the best way to file insurance claim after accident, patience becomes a virtue. Rushing to settle often means leaving money on the table, especially before reaching maximum medical improvement. The most successful claimants methodically document every expense and impact while allowing the full extent of damages to become clear. In 2025, many attorneys recommend creating a “day-in-the-life” video documenting challenges caused by injuries, which can be powerful during settlement discussions.
Mastering how to negotiate car accident settlement requires understanding when to involve legal professionals. While minor fender-benders might be handled independently, serious accidents with injuries or complex liability issues nearly always benefit from expert representation. Contemporary personal injury attorneys often work on contingency and provide free initial consultations, making professional guidance accessible regardless of financial situation. Their knowledge of current case law and insurer tactics can dramatically affect your final compensation amount.
